Crossroads Counseling

CrossRoads Counseling Ministries is a multi-denominational, distinctively Christian counseling service which began in 2007. CrossRoads serves the needs of individuals, families, & couples regardless of church affiliation.

The name, “CrossRoads”, was inspired by the book of Jeremiah 6:16 “Stand at the crossroads and look, ask for the ancient paths, ask where the good way is, and walk in it, and you will find rest for your souls.”


Those who are in need, those who are hurting because of life’s circumstances whether those circumstances are loss of a job, loss of a relationship, loss of freedom due to an addiction, loss of self worth due to depression, the list could go on and on -- all of these people “stand at the crossroads”. They look for direction, they look for answers, and they look for help in deciding “where the good way is”. They all long for “rest for their souls”.
